#365ef4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#365ef4 is composed of 21.2% red, 36.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 58.4%. #365ef4 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cbcff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#365ef4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#365ef4 has RGB values of R:54, G:94,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3563252.

Shades and Tints of #365ef4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f0f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#365ef4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90929a is the less saturated color, while #2e59fc is the most saturated one.
